Small plane crashes in Kingston, Ontario, killing seven: local police

(Reuters) - A small plane crashed in a wooded area on the outskirts of Kingston, Ontario on Wednesday evening, killing seven people, local police said.

The Transportation Safety Board of Canada (TSB) said it would send a team to investigate the crash.

Seven individuals in the Piper PA-32 aircraft died and police will continue to work jointly with the TSB as the investigation continues, Kingston Police said http://bit.ly/2QZt8tp in a statement.

The Piper PA-32 is a single-engine aircraft, which seats five to six people.
